About Hao Lai
Hao Lai is a scholar working on Pulmonary and Respiratory Medicine, Surgery, Cardiology and Cardiovascular Medicine, Molecular Biology and Oncology, having authored 131 papers that have together received 1.5k indexed citations. Recurring topics across this work include Aortic Disease and Treatment Approaches (35 papers), Cardiac Valve Diseases and Treatments (25 papers), Aortic aneurysm repair treatments (22 papers), Cardiac Structural Anomalies and Repair (15 papers), Tissue Engineering and Regenerative Medicine (9 papers), RNA Interference and Gene Delivery (9 papers), Electrospun Nanofibers in Biomedical Applications (7 papers) and Cardiac, Anesthesia and Surgical Outcomes (7 papers). The work is most often cited by research in Cancer Research (202 citations), Pulmonary and Respiratory Medicine (391 citations), Cardiology and Cardiovascular Medicine (264 citations), Reproductive Medicine (76 citations) and Surgery (391 citations). Hao Lai has collaborated with scholars based in China, Australia and United States. Frequent co-authors include Kai Zhu, Chunsheng Wang, Xianwei Mo, Changfa Guo, Jiansi Chen, Chunsheng Wang, Yuan Lin, Yulin Wang, Jun Li and Jun Li. Their work appears in journals such as Interactive Cardiovascular and Thoracic Surgery, PLoS ONE, Nutrients, The Annals of Thoracic Surgery and Tumor Biology.
